Literature summary for 2.7.11.1 extracted from

  • Lower, B.H.; Kennelly, P.J.
    The membrane-associated protein-serine/threonine kinase from Sulfolobus solfataricus is a glycoprotein. (2002), J. Bacteriol., 184, 2614-2619.

Posttranslational Modification

Posttranslational Modification Comment Organism
glycoprotein the glycosylated enzyme binds to Galanthus nivalis agglutinin Saccharolobus solfataricus
phosphoprotein the enzyme performs autophosphorylation in vitro Saccharolobus solfataricus

Purification (Commentary)

Purification (Comment) Organism
native enzyme from membranes partially by detergent solubilization and anion exchange chromatography Saccharolobus solfataricus
